Olympus XZ-1 vs Ricoh WG-5 GPS Physical Comparison

For anyone who is looking to travel with your camera often, you need to factor in its weight and measurements. The Olympus XZ-1 has got exterior dimensions of 111mm x 65mm x 42mm (4.4" x 2.6" x 1.7") having a weight of 275 grams (0.61 lbs) while the Ricoh WG-5 GPS has proportions of 125mm x 65mm x 32mm (4.9" x 2.6" x 1.3") along with a weight of 236 grams (0.52 lbs).

Olympus XZ-1 vs Ricoh WG-5 GPS Sensor Comparison

In many cases, it is very tough to visualise the difference between sensor dimensions simply by reviewing a spec sheet. The pic here might give you a far better sense of the sensor dimensions in the XZ-1 and WG-5 GPS.

Clearly, both of those cameras have got different megapixel count and different sensor dimensions. The XZ-1 because of its bigger sensor will make getting shallow DOF easier and the Ricoh WG-5 GPS will offer you extra detail due to its extra 6 Megapixels. Higher resolution will also make it easier to crop photographs much more aggressively. The more aged XZ-1 is going to be behind with regard to sensor tech.
